An NGO called Connected Development (CODE) has underscored the importance of actively engaging Nigeria’s youth in the development of credible leadership at all levels. The NGO believes that this is crucial for enhancing civic capacity and ensuring the long-term sustainability of the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) in Nigeria.

During the ‘Follow the Money Campus Tour’ held at Kaduna State University (KASU), Mr. Kingsley Agu, the Community Engagement Director of CODE, emphasized the need to promote accountability and transparency by involving young people in monitoring projects. He pointed out that youth participation in governance processes is essential, given that they constitute 70 percent of the population.

Agu stated that the gathering at KASU aimed to mobilize youth to monitor constituency projects, including the implementation of TETFund projects, and foster their interest in government spending. He highlighted that when young people develop valuable skills and self-confidence, it contributes to the nation’s capacity-building and the grooming of effective leaders for the next generation.

Abubakar Muhammad, CODE’s Project Assistant, mentioned that the organization, through its ‘Follow the Money’ initiative, has tracked various government projects. He emphasized that international aid spending in rural communities promotes open government and efficient service delivery.

Muhammad added that the campus tour aimed to educate and sensitize students about the importance of project tracking and governance. The campus tour is part of the ‘Deepening Citizens’ Interest in Government Spending and Addressing Accompanying Corrupt Practices (DeSPAAC)’ project, supported by the MacArthur Foundation.

Muhammad further explained that the campus tour sought to empower students in higher education institutions to demand accountability and transparency in their immediate environments and from the government. As part of this effort to combat corruption, the event featured a panel discussion covering topics such as social responsibility, social accountability, community service, and social consciousness. Panelists included representatives from the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C).

Hadiza Umar, the Citizens Co-Chairman of Open Government Partnership, stressed that since the Kaduna Government had joined the OGP platform, citizens, including students, must actively participate in governance. She encouraged students to assume a responsible role in governance to secure a better future for themselves.

A new dimension has been added to the leadership crisis within the African Democratic Congress (ADC), as factional figure Nafiu Bala has accused former party national chairman Ralph Nwosu of allegedly deceiving him into attending a major party gathering.....KINDLY READ THE FULL STORY HERE▶

Speaking in an interview on AIT on Monday, Bala said he was invited under the impression that the meeting was a routine event meant to welcome new entrants into the party. However, he claimed he later discovered that the gathering was actually organised to unveil a new leadership structure reportedly headed by David Mark.

He explained that the true nature of the event only became clear after proceedings had already commenced, adding that it coincided with the resignation of Nwosu and the announcement of a new set of party executives.

According to Bala, the development represented a significant turning point in the internal crisis within the ADC, noting that the emergence of a leadership bloc associated with David Mark and other figures deepened existing divisions in the party.

Bala alleged that he was initially told the event was a simple adoption of new members, but later realized it was a formal handover involving the new coalition leadership. He also said that on the same day, Nwosu announced his resignation while unveiling new party officials, including names such as David Mark and Rauf Aregbesola.

He added that the situation further escalated tensions within the party, as different factions continued to contest control of the ADC structure.

Following the event, Bala said he moved to address the developments through internal party channels, including convening consultations and a National Executive Council meeting about a week later.

He further stated that after the consultations, he notified the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) of his position as deputy national chairman and declared himself acting national chairman of the party.

Bala also alleged that the crisis worsened after he discovered what he described as irregularities, including claims that his signature was forged on documents linked to the resignation of some party officials. He said the disputed documents were used to facilitate the emergence of a new leadership team.

He concluded by saying he had taken legal steps against the faction aligned with David Mark and also made his position public through media channels.

Former federal lawmaker, Ishaku Abbo, has officially left the African Democratic Congress (ADC) and is expected to announce his new political platform later this week.....KINDLY READ THE FULL STORY HERE▶

Abbo announced his departure on Monday morning, attributing the decision to the ongoing internal crisis within the ADC in Adamawa State. His exit comes just 48 hours after another major faction within the party, aligned with Senator Aishatu Dahiru Ahmed, also known as Binani, withdrew from the party.

Reports indicate that the ADC in Adamawa has been experiencing deep divisions, with a bloc loyal to Binani recently announcing a mass resignation following a stakeholders’ meeting held at the residence of Hon. Mijiyewa Umaru Kugama.

In a communiqué issued after the meeting, the group, drawn from all three senatorial districts in the state, accused the party leadership of weakening internal democracy and violating key principles guiding party operations.

They further argued that recent congresses conducted within the party were flawed and no longer reflected the will of members, describing the current structure in Adamawa as unacceptable and lacking legitimacy.

The developments highlight escalating tensions within the ADC in the state, as more prominent members continue to exit amid leadership disputes.
